About Waverley Meadows Preschool
Waverley Meadows Preschool, located in Wheelers Hill on the land of the Boon wurrung People of the Kulin Nations, offers high-quality funded three and four-year-old Kindergarten programs. We are rated Exceeding the National Quality Standard in all seven quality areas (September 2025).
Our pedagogy is deeply informed by the Reggio Emilia approach, creating environments of wonder, investigation, and connection to nature and culture. Educators engage in project work with children, following their ideas and inquiries to build meaningful, collaborative learning experiences. Programs are guided by the Victorian Early Years Learning and Development Framework (VEYLDF), co‑designed with children, families, and educators. We are proud of our Nature Kindergarten program and strong community partnerships, including Seeing Eye Dogs Australia (SEDA), and the Stephanie Alexander Kitchen Garden Foundation.
Statement of Commitment to Child Safety
1. Waverley Meadows Preschool is committed to the safety and wellbeing of all children and young people. This is the primary focus of our care and decision‑making.
2. We have zero tolerance for child abuse.
3. We provide a safe environment where children feel safe, respected, and heard.
4. We pay particular attention to the cultural safety of Aboriginal children, children from culturally and linguistically diverse backgrounds, and children with disability.
5. Every person at Waverley Meadows Preschool has a responsibility to prioritise the safety and wellbeing of children in all actions and decisions.
